Key Strategies to Improve Your Response Time
Improving your response time can significantly impact your freelance success. By prioritizing tasks, you can focus on what’s most important first. Setting deadlines for yourself helps maintain momentum and keeps projects on track. To boost communication efficiency, find the best methods to connect with your clients—whether it’s email, chat, or video calls. Streamlined processes save time; consider templates or automation tools to reduce repetitive work.
Here’s a quick overview of effective strategies:
| Strategy | Benefits | Tools |
|---|---|---|
| Prioritizing tasks | Focus on critical work | To-do apps, checklists |
| Setting deadlines | Stay accountable | Calendar reminders |
| Communication efficiency | Clear expectations | Slack, Zoom |
| Streamlined processes | Save time | Trello, automation |
Implementing quick feedback loops ensures you meet client expectations, making you a standout freelancer.

Tools for Faster Project Delivery
When you leverage the right tools, you can significantly improve your project delivery speed without sacrificing quality. Embracing technology for workflow optimization can streamline your processes, making you a more efficient freelancer.
Here are four essential tools to consider for faster project delivery:
- Trello – Visually manage tasks and timelines, perfect for tracking progress at a glance.
- Slack – Foster real-time communication with clients and team members to keep everyone on the same page.
- Asana – Organize project management and set deadlines to ensure you stay on track.
- Google Drive – Easily share and collaborate on documents, reducing time spent on file transfers.
